After much delay the Xalan-J 2.7.1 release is underway.

According to section 5.3 j) of our charter at
http://xalan.apache.org/charter.html
75% of the PMC members need to vote +1 on the release. I'm going to
kick this vote off right away.

The proposed code for 2.7.1 is in subversion at:
      http://svn.apache.org/repos/asf/xalan/java/tags/xalan-j_2_7_1

This tag actually existed 7 months ago, but I just deleted the old one and
created
a new one based on trunk since it picks up some fixes.

Besides the PMC vote another thing is quality; I'm going to find a
"volunteer" to run tests.

Lastly is the publishing of the release and website. I've done it before so
I'll do this
myself when we get to that point.
